What does a wireless embedded software engineer do?

A Wireless Embedded Software Engineer designs, develops, and maintains software that runs on embedded systems, such as microcontrollers, with a focus on wireless communication protocols (e.g., Wi-Fi, Bluetooth, Zigbee). They work closely with hardware engineers to ensure seamless integration between hardware and software components. Their responsibilities include writing firmware, debugging issues, optimizing performance, and ensuring reliable wireless data transfer. These engineers are crucial in industries like IoT, telecommunications, and consumer electronics, where wireless connectivity is essential.

What are some common challenges wireless embedded software engineers face when integrating new wireless protocols into existing systems?

Wireless Embedded Software Engineers often encounter challenges such as ensuring compatibility between legacy hardware and new wireless protocols, maintaining low power consumption, and optimizing for limited memory and processing resources. Debugging and testing wireless communication in real-world environments can also be complex due to unpredictable interference and signal degradation. Collaborating closely with hardware engineers and firmware developers is essential to address these integration issues effectively.

What is the difference between Wireless Embedded Software Engineer vs Firmware Engineer?

AspectWireless Embedded Software EngineerFirmware Engineer
Required CredentialsBachelor's in Electrical Engineering, Computer Science, or related; knowledge of wireless protocolsBachelor's in Electrical Engineering, Computer Science, or related; embedded systems experience
Work EnvironmentDesigning wireless communication systems, embedded devices, IoT productsDeveloping low-level code for hardware devices, embedded systems
Industry UsageTelecommunications, IoT, consumer electronicsConsumer electronics, automotive, industrial equipment

Wireless Embedded Software Engineers focus on developing software for wireless communication modules within embedded systems, often working on IoT and connectivity solutions. Firmware Engineers primarily develop low-level code that directly interacts with hardware components. While both roles require embedded systems knowledge, Wireless Embedded Software Engineers emphasize wireless protocols and connectivity, whereas Firmware Engineers concentrate on hardware-level programming.
